The estate had belonged to a William Lawrence, that owed 7000 to Robert Claxton and Boy.




He paid the financial obligation by giving the estate to the Claxtons until he can pay the cash. Claxton passed estate to William Weare of Abbots Leigh, Bristol, to settle 10,000 funding which he owed to Weare. G. W. Braikenridge had been the mortgagee of the estate in 1818. The acts likewise include duplicates of a number in indentures at different days and info about 45 acres of land purchased from the Pinney household. The Hale Bequest held by Bristol Record Workplace includes product from the Braikenridge household. Paintings notes Braikenridge a patron of the Bristol College of artists. In middle cj hole brislington bristol ages England, St Anne, a slightly apocraphyl saint, stated to be the mommy of Mary, was commonly celebrated. On the borders of modern-day Bristol is one relic from today. St. Anne's Well is probably all that is left of a larger website, which consisted of a kept in mind chapel without a doubt it is the chapel which has an older a lot more age-old history. Currently the church shows click to read more up have failed to remember the well, yet not the locals who each Saturday local to the old saint's feast day go in procession to the well. The present party of this kept in mindholy well is possibly even more of a contrived personalized than revived possibly however although it is greatly removed of its religious emphasis is no much less significant. Nonetheless, initial' modern 'processions to the well begun in 1880s with the beginning of regional Catholic presence. In 1927 the Reverend C F. Harman lead the first twentieth century procession to the well and held a service there consequently it ended up being an annual event only declining obviously in the 1970s as the site ended up being vandalised and gradually derelict. Then the procession was led by rural Dean Dad John Bradley that according to Ken Taylor's 2016 service the well and church, The Holy Wells and Church of St Anne in the Timber, Brislington, Bristol:" snaked via St. Anne's Timber tothe divine well where a solution was held collectively with the Rev. The website is bounded by public roads, with Bathroom Roadway creating the southerly limit, Ironmould Lane developing the eastern and northern limits , and Broomhill Road and Emery Roadway forming the western border. The north, east, and west boundaries are noted by high rock wall surfaces, while the south boundary is confined by C20 cord fences. The entry exists in the direction of the centre of the southerly border. It is marked by a set of tall, square-section ashlar piers, from which low quadrant wall surfaces expand back to a pair of reduced, square-section stone piers with domed caps which frame the entry to the drive.
